Will my insurance cover addiction treatment?+

Yes, under the Affordable Care Act (ACA), mental health and substance use disorder treatment are classified as Essential Health Benefits. Most private insurance plans, Medicaid, and Medicare cover some or all detox and rehabilitation services.

Why We Recommend This: The Science of Addiction Recovery

Recovery is not a one-size-fits-all process. The programs recommended through our network are grounded in neuroscience and behavioral psychology. We strictly emphasize evidence-based protocols such as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T), and FDA-approved Medication-Assisted Treatment (MAT). These clinical approaches have been repeatedly shown to reduce relapse rates and support long-term neural pathway healing.
